Geography
East Africa straddles the equator in the central portion of the African continent. The independent countries of Kenya and Tanzania cover most of the territory. A highland plateau, crowned by the snow-capped peaks of Mount Kilimanjaro, extends over much of the region. It is the habitat for many African wildlife species. The 653 square mile Masai Mara National Reserve is home to large populations of elephant, hippo, buffalo, giraffe, gazelle, zebra and impala. Predators are plentiful - especially cheetah, leopard and large prides of lion. Vast numbers of birds that breed in Europe and Asia fly to Africa to spend the fall, winter and spring. East Africa is an Ornithogist's paradise.

Ethnic Groups
Throughout East Africa there are numerous ethnic groups with unique cultural traditions. Among the better-known are the Bajun, Kikiyu, Samburu and Turkana. Perhaps the most famous is the Masai tribe. Until as recently as 100 years ago the Masai ruled over much of East Africa. Now concentrated in southern Kenya and northern Tanzania, they cling tenaciously to their culture and customs. To describe the Masai's attitude toward their cattle as mystical is not an exaggeration - they believe any pursuit other than cattle herding is demeaning to themselves and insulting to their god. The Masai's many rites of passage give their lives a profound meaning. The rhythms of nature and native traditions sound loudly in Kenya.
